A Comprehensive Guide to Guttering InstallationWhen it concerns safeguarding a home versus water damage, proper guttering installation is a crucial aspect that lots of house owners might frequently neglect. Gutters play an important role in directing rainwater away from the roof structure, the foundation of your house, and landscaped areas. Repair My Windows And Doors looks into the ins and outs of gutter installation, analyzing materials, methods, and FAQs to help house owners comprehend and perform this vital job.Why Gutter Installation MattersBefore we dive into the specifics of installation, let's check out why gutters are necessary:Prevent Water Damage: Gutters channel water away from the structure, avoiding costly repairs due to water build-up or disintegration.Preserve Landscaping: By controlling water flow, gutters assist maintain the charm and health of yards and gardens.Prevent Mold Growth: Water pooling around the structure can result in mold and mildew, which can impact indoor air quality and lead to health issues.Boost Curb Appeal: Properly set up and preserved gutters add to the total aesthetic worth of the home.Key Components of GutteringBefore starting the installation process, it's crucial to comprehend the fundamental components of a gutter system:ComponentDescriptionGuttersChannels that gather water from the roof.DownspoutsVertical pipelines that direct water from gutters to the ground or a drainage system.ElbowsAngled fittings that link areas of gutter or reroute water downspouts.Gutter GuardsMesh screens put over gutters to avoid debris accumulation.HangersFasteners that secure gutters to the structure.Types of Gutter MaterialsThe choice of material largely affects the installation process, longevity, and maintenance of the gutter system. Below prevail materials utilized in gutter installation, together with their advantages and disadvantages:MaterialProsConsVinylLight-weight, rust-resistant, low expenseCan end up being breakable in severe temperaturesAluminumCorrosion-resistant, readily available in different colorsMay damage or bend quickly under pressureGalvanized SteelExtremely long lasting, strongCan rust gradually if not correctly preservedCopperHighly long lasting, adds aesthetic valueCostly, needs soldering for installationZincLong-lasting and resistant to deteriorationMore pricey than other productsTools and Materials Needed for Gutter InstallationHere's a list of items you will usually need for gutter installation:Materials: Gutters, downspouts, elbows, wall mounts, and sealant.Tools: Measuring tapeLevelMiter saw or hacksawPower drillLadderShatterproof glass and glovesCaulk gunStep-by-Step Guttering Installation GuideInstallation of gutters can appear complicated, but following a systematic technique makes the task manageable. Here's how to install gutters:Step 1: Measure and PlanProcedure the Roofline: Start by measuring the length and slope of the roof.Style the Layout: Plan the gutter system, choosing where downspouts will be positioned to guarantee water circulation is optimum.Action 2: Cut the GuttersCut to Size: Based on your measurements, cut the gutters to the desired lengths utilizing a miter saw or a hacksaw.Prepare Elbows: If required, prepare elbows for corners.Action 3: Install the GuttersAttach Hangers: Install hangers along the length of the gutters, guaranteeing they are spaced about two feet apart.Protect the Gutter: Place the gutters onto the hangers and secure them.Ensure a Slope: Check that the gutters slope down toward the downspouts (usually a 1-inch slope for each 10 feet of gutter).Step 4: Install DownspoutsMark the Position: Identify and mark where downspouts will be set up.Cut Downspouts to Length: Cut the downspouts to the needed height.Link to Gutters: Use elbows to link the downspouts to the gutters, protecting them with brackets.Step 5: Seal and TestSeal Connections: Apply sealant at all joints and connections to avoid leaks.Evaluate the System: Run water through the system to ensure appropriate flow and check for leaks.Step 6: Install Gutter Guards (Optional)Consider setting up gutter guards to avoid leaves and debris from blocking the system. This can significantly reduce the need for maintenance.Maintenance Tips for GuttersRegular maintenance is key to ensuring the longevity and performance of your gutter system. Here are some essential maintenance tips:Clear Debris: Remove leaves and particles a minimum of twice a year.Examine for Damage: Regularly examine for rust, leaks, and loose hangers.Examine Slopes: Ensure the gutters keep a correct slope.Flush Gutters: Use a hose pipe to flush out dirt and look for any clogs.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)What is the perfect slope for gutters?A slope of about 1 inch for every 10 feet of gutter is normally advised to guarantee appropriate drainage.How frequently should I clean my gutters?It is recommended to tidy gutters a minimum of twice a year, ideally in the spring and fall.Can I install gutters myself?Yes, if you are comfortable with DIY tasks and have the required tools, installing gutters can be a satisfying task.What are gutter guards, and do I need them?Gutter guards are devices that prevent debris from going into the gutter. They can be helpful for minimizing maintenance.How long do gutters last?Depending on the product, gutters can last anywhere from 10 to 50 years, with copper gutters tending to have the longest lifespan.Investing effort and time into appropriate gutter installation can conserve house owners a fortune in repairs and maintenance down the line. By selecting the right materials, staying up to date with regular maintenance, and understanding the installation process, any property owner can ensure their home remains safeguarded from water damage for several years to come. Whether you choose to DIY or hire a professional, comprehending the intricacies of guttering is a step towards being an accountable homeowner.
